Career path
| Career Role | Description |
|---|---|
| Sales Manager (Sales & Supply Chain Management) | Leads sales teams, develops strategies, and ensures supply chain efficiency meets sales targets. A professional diploma enhances strategic thinking and supply chain understanding. |
| Supply Chain Analyst (Supply Chain & Logistics) | Analyzes supply chain data, identifies areas for improvement, and optimizes logistics. Diploma holders possess advanced analytical skills and problem-solving abilities. |
| Procurement Specialist (Procurement & Supply Chain) | Sources materials, negotiates contracts, and manages supplier relationships. A professional diploma provides expertise in procurement strategies and supply chain integration. |
| Logistics Coordinator (Logistics & Supply Chain Management) | Coordinates the flow of goods, manages transportation, and ensures timely delivery. Diploma qualification demonstrates proficiency in logistics operations and supply chain principles. |
| Sales Operations Manager (Sales Operations & Supply Chain) | Optimizes sales processes, integrates sales and supply chain data, and improves forecasting accuracy. Strong supply chain knowledge, gained through a diploma, is highly advantageous. |
